Linux清理內(nèi)存對磁盤的影響
Linux操作系統(tǒng)具有強大的內(nèi)存管理功能,可以自動管理和優(yōu)化內(nèi)存使用。當(dāng)系統(tǒng)運行一段時間后,內(nèi)存中可能會積累大量的緩存和緩沖區(qū),這些占用的內(nèi)存可以通過清理來釋放,以提高系統(tǒng)的性能。清理內(nèi)存對磁盤的影響是一個需要注意的問題。
清理內(nèi)存通常會導(dǎo)致一部分緩存和緩沖區(qū)被釋放,這些數(shù)據(jù)會被寫回到磁盤中。這個過程稱為"內(nèi)存回寫",它將內(nèi)存中的數(shù)據(jù)同步到磁盤上,以確保數(shù)據(jù)的持久性。內(nèi)存回寫會占用一定的磁盤帶寬和IO資源,可能會導(dǎo)致磁盤讀寫負(fù)載增加。
這種對磁盤的影響通常是短暫的,并且在大多數(shù)情況下是可以接受的。Linux內(nèi)核會智能地調(diào)整內(nèi)存回寫的速度,以避免對磁盤造成過大的負(fù)載?,F(xiàn)代磁盤和文件系統(tǒng)也具有較強的性能和緩存機制,可以有效地處理這些回寫操作。
清理內(nèi)存可以釋放出大量的可用內(nèi)存,使系統(tǒng)可以更好地響應(yīng)新的應(yīng)用程序和進程的需求。這對于提高系統(tǒng)的整體性能和穩(wěn)定性非常重要。當(dāng)系統(tǒng)內(nèi)存不足時,可能會導(dǎo)致應(yīng)用程序運行緩慢甚至崩潰,而清理內(nèi)存可以有效地解決這個問題。
清理內(nèi)存會對磁盤產(chǎn)生一定的影響,但這種影響通常是短暫的,并且可以通過現(xiàn)代的硬件和軟件機制來緩解。清理內(nèi)存可以釋放出可用內(nèi)存,提高系統(tǒng)的性能和穩(wěn)定性。定期清理內(nèi)存是維護Linux系統(tǒng)健康運行的重要步驟之一。
希望以上內(nèi)容對你有幫助,如果還有其他問題,請隨時提問。